The Field Auditor will set up retail performance management and commence auditing the performance of shops in terms of customer care, sales support, shop management and stock management.

REQUIREMENTS

  • Bachelor’s degree in any field.
  • At least 3 years’ experience in stock management or 2 years as operations and stock auditor in a similar company.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office with basic MS Excel and MS word knowledge and good reporting skills
  • Detail oriented, excellent organizational skills, and problem-solving abilities.
  • Ability to work with tight deadlines.
  • Good time management, punctuality, and timeliness.
  • Clear communication on email, telephone, in person.
  • Ability to manage overlapping timelines and create task schedules/calendars.
  • Exceptional work ethic and compliance to company Anti-bribery and Corruption policy.
  • Able to self-manage and take initiative without being micro-managed.

Responsibilities:

  • The main purpose of a field auditor is to perform proper inventory and compliance audits as well as auditing if the operations and service offered by the retail team are consistent with M-KOPA best practice.
  • Leading in setting up audit and improving retail audit processes in Nigeria.
  • Performing physical counts and reconciliation of variances in all M-Kopa outlets.
  • Analysis of stock audit results and using these in monitoring and reporting of service performance at the stock locations, identify areas and opportunities for improvement.
  • Accurately and objectively scoring shops using the laid down processes during audits.
  • Work with warehouse team and stock allocation team to perform investigations on the stock variances and provide feedback and solution on stocks audit.
  • Performing key compliance checks in the M-Kopa Retail outlets i.e., on Branding, Look & Feel, Covid compliance, Record keeping, adherence to company processes etc. and the suitability of the outlet in the preservation and security of stock or any company property.
  • Reporting of all audit findings through detailed preparation of reports and feedback to shops.
  • Escalating of any suspicious/fraudulent activities picked out while performing their daily tasks.
  • Provide support as required to resolve issues arising in the field.
  • Other duties as assigned by the manager.
